5 People Displaced By Fire In Capitol Hill Neighborhood

DENVER (CBS4) - A fire in the Capitol Hill neighborhood in Denver Thursday morning has left five people out of their home. The Denver Fire Department responded to a house fire off 11th Street and Washington Avenue at 7 a.m.

Firefighters say no one was hurt and residents were able to get out safely on their own.

James Foy said he couldn't believe what he encountered when his home caught fire.

"I tried walking out my back door and hit a wall of flame and I got out the front door with the clothes on my back, basically," said Foy.

"It was a little bit scary. I mean, don't get me wrong, when you're in that, it's reaction mode."

The back of the building is badly burned.

Fire crews are investigating what caused the fire.
